Reasons That Prevent You From Accessing QB Company File Data

This list of reasons points out the factors due to which QuickBooks 6000 error codes occur:

  • If the configuration files, which are the Network Data file and Transaction Log file, are corrupted or defective, you will have issues accessing the QB data.

  • Firewall programs on computers can restrict your access to company files.

  • Another reason is network issues.

How to Swiftly Resolve QuickBooks 6000 Errors

Follow the fixes given below for effective results:

  • Utilize the Tool Hub and launch the QuickBooks File Doctor tool.

  • Relocating the company file data folder will help you fix the issue.

  • Rename your configuration files.
